  Lamborghini Murciélago R-GT      

  Article Image gallery (77) Specifications User Comments (5)  
Click here to open the Lamborghini Murciélago R-GT gallery   
Country of origin:Italy
Produced in:2003
Numbers built:7 (At least)
Introduced at:2003 Frankfurt Motor Show
